Egyptian
Pronunciation
- (modern Egyptological) IPA(key): /d͡ʒɛr/
- Conventional anglicization: djer
Noun
|
m
- limit, end

Preposition
|
- since, from the time of
- (often with a verb in the terminative as object) since, because

Adverb
|
- done, over, finished
Proper noun
|
m
- A serekh name notably borne by Djer, a pharaoh of the First Dynasty
